Abstract

The invention discloses a SysML framework based on Type Script. The SysML framework comprises a SysML domain meta-model and a maintenance assembly for organizing and managing the SysML domain meta-model, wherein the SysML domain meta-model is formed by combining a UML and an Ecore, an Element class of the UML directly inherits a model object EObject of the Ecore, and all inheritance types of modelelements are obtained by adopting a breadth search algorithm based on a queue; the maintenance assembly comprises a resource pool, a model tree and a reference pool, model elements organized in parallel are stored in the resource pool, and the model tree is used for maintaining parent-child relationships and reference relationships of the model elements; the reference pool serves as a communication bridge between the resource pool and the external reference interface and records the state of the model element when the model element is referenced. The invention further discloses a Web system engineering modeling platform.

technical field [0001] The invention belongs to the technical field of SysML modeling, and in particular relates to a TypeScript-based SysML framework and a Web system engineering modeling platform. Background technique [0002] TypeScript is an open source, cross-platform programming language developed by Microsoft. It is a superset of JavaScript and will eventually be compiled into JavaScript code. [0003] UML (Unified Modeling Language, Unified Modeling Language) is a standard language for describing, visualizing and documenting object-oriented system products. It is a non-patented third-generation modeling and specification language. UML uses the modeling tools of object-oriented design, but is independent of any specific programming language.
